Output cedcca208529df3cda44aac960e17853dfd651018c296dc95fcaecf5bc38eea4:1

value
40000
script pubkey
OP_0 OP_PUSHBYTES_32 754d5c87689e2c757a91497d51b4b9a639f3e5874c8d8a68517ef52a46e4f933
address
bc1qw4x4epmgnck82753f974rd9e5cul8ev8fjxc56z30m6j53hylyescpd5jg
transaction
cedcca208529df3cda44aac960e17853dfd651018c296dc95fcaecf5bc38eea4
confirmations
257776
spent
true